“Covering a lifetime of experience, this book details the development of a remarkable garden made by one woman on a low income. Suited to its dry climate, the garden (in central Victoria) is an example and encouragement to anyone wanting to create a garden of their own under conditions of restricted rainfall and extreme temperatures. Giving much practical advice on garden design, plant choices and maintenance, the book is also an account of the many influences, both philosophical and practical, shaping these gardening choices and ultimately a life.” (publisher’s blurb)
